    SOUP

    From Shadows to Spotlights, from Rejection to Redemption

    by Monnelia Kennedy

    What happens when the search for love and belonging begins at home— but home is the last place you belong?

    Born to a young nurse who arrived in 1960s Leeds from Barbados, Monnelia’s life begins with rejection. Her mother, drawn to adventure but unable to embrace motherhood, sends her daughter to a string of unqualified foster carers. Years later, mother and daughter are reunited—but their relationship is a battlefield, fraught with competition, secrecy, and a struggle for identity.

    From her tumultuous childhood to success as a fashion model in London, Monnelia defies the odds, overcoming dyslexia to earn a degree in Arts Management and becoming a trailblazer in the world of disability advocacy. SOUP is a powerful story of survival, self-discovery, and breaking free from the past to shape a brighter future.

Author

Monnelia Kennedy

Monnelia is a British author, model, and property investor whose journey spans foster care, hardship, and success in modelling and business. Passionate about travelling, she volunteers with charities supporting women back into work and advocates for disability inclusion in the arts. SOUP shares her inspiring life story.
